I had a bit of trouble on the final boss too. The trick to beating it and not driving yourself crazy can be done by using Sentinals. Simply put, the boss has a countdown timer. When it gets to about 1, do a round of healing to get your characters as close to full health as possible, then switch to a paradigm where at least Noel and Serah are both sentinals. You can have all three characters set as sentinals, but that will take up a monster slot. It's up to you. After you change to sentinals, use a skill like "Steel Guard". You have to make sure to change to the sentinal paradigm before the animation of one of the "flare" attacks starts, because you can't change during the attack. If you've been using this or a similar strategy and are still being demolished, I don't know what to say, except, if you are using only one sentinal, it doesn't seem to mitigate enough damage. This is what I did for a while. I tried to switch just Noel to a sentinal with the other two as medics, but it wasn't uncommon for everyone to die. When at least two out of three were sentinals, I beat it much easier. Hope this helps.
